History and development:
On-line poker surfaced inside late 1990s because of developments in technology in addition to net. The first internet poker room, globe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ate community. However, it was at the first 2000s that online poker practiced exponential development, mainly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
Recognition and Accessibility:
One of the most significant reasons for the immense rise in popularity of internet poker is its ease of access. Players can log in to a common internet poker platforms anytime, from anywhere, using their computer systems or mobile devices. This convenience features drawn a varied player base, including recreational people to experts, adding to the quick growth of internet poker.
Features of Internet Poker:
On-line poker provides a number of advantages over old-fashioned br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it gives a wider selection of online game options, including different poker variants and stakes, providing toward preferences and spending plans of all of the kinds of players. In addition, internet poker rooms tend to be open 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of real highstakes Casino running hours. Additionally, internet based platforms usually offer attractive bonuses, respect programs, while the capacity to play numerous tables simultaneously, improving the general video gaming knowledge.
Challenges and Regulation:
Although the internet poker business thrives, it faces difficulties by means of regulation and security concerns. Governing bodies globally have actually implemented varying examples of regulation to safeguard players and give a wide berth to fraudulent tasks. Also, internet poker systems need robust security steps to shield people' individual and financial information, guaranteeing a secure playing environment.
Economic and Personal Influence:
The rise of on-line poker has had a significant economic impact globally. On-line poker systems create significant revenue through rake charges, event entry costs, and advertising. This income has resulted in task creation and opportunities when you look at the video gaming business. Furthermore, internet poker has actually added to an increase in taxation income for governments in which it really is managed, encouraging public services.
From a social viewpoint, on-line poker has actually fostered an international poker neighborhood, bridging geographic barriers. Players from diverse backgrounds and locations can communicate and contend, cultivating a feeling of camaraderie. Internet poker has also played an important role to promote the overall game's popularity and attracting brand new players, ultimately causing the development associated with poker business overall.
